R-Tree-construction-via-Bulk-Loading

This program calculates the MBRs of objects and then bulk loading the tree after sorting the MBRs using a space fill curve (space-filling curve), more specifically the z-order. These curves are functions, which map a multidimensional vector to a number in the one-dimensional space. Two spatially close objects are very likely to correspond to nearby prices.

Consequently, two MBRs that are close to space will most likely enter the same leaf of the tree.

Examples of input files are given. Coords.txt and offset.txt

The coords.txt contains point coordinates in the form (x, y).

The offset.txt contains entries of the form (id), (startOffset), (endOffset) where id is the unique identifier of a polygon object and start offset (respectively end offset) is the no. line in the coords.txt file where the coordinates of the points that form the begin (respectively end) each object.

command line : python3 Rtree_BL.py coords.txt offsets.txt
